University of Otago – Otago Council Inc Scholarships in Science, 2026
These scholarships are aimed at Master’s students who are carrying out research in agriculture, pastoral, forestry, fishing, transport, communications, mining, energy, construction, scientific development, or natural resources in the Otago region.
Eligibility
- Open to both domestic and international students.
- Applicants must be pursuing their first Master’s qualification.
- Research must be focused on one of the specified fields in the Otago region.
Application Process
Prospective candidates must submit an application form to the University of Otago to be considered for the scholarship.
Value
- Successful applicants receive a one‑time payment of NZD 3,000.
Deadline
Applications are accepted throughout the year, but the final submission deadline is 10 August 2026.
